New Jersey 2026-2027 Regular Session

New Jersey Senate Bill SCR77

Introduced
2/2/26  

Caption

Proposes constitutional amendment to permit Legislature to extend eligibility to receive veterans' property tax deduction to surviving spouse of nonresident veteran in certain circumstances.

Impact

If enacted, the amendment would modify Article VIII, Section I, paragraph 3 of the New Jersey Constitution. The change allows surviving spouses of veterans, who do not meet the strict residency requirement at the time of the veteran's death, to still benefit from a financial deduction. This adjustment is of particular importance as it recognizes the sacrifices made by veterans and aims to provide continued financial support to their families, likely benefiting many residents and enhancing their financial security.

Summary

SCR77 is a proposed constitutional amendment in New Jersey that aims to extend the eligibility for the veterans' property tax deduction to the surviving spouses of nonresident veterans under certain circumstances. Specifically, the bill enables the legislature to provide an annual property tax deduction of $250 to the surviving spouse of a veteran who was honorably discharged from military service but was not a resident of New Jersey at the time of death. The proposed amendment underscores the significance of the veteran having lived in the state at some point before and after military service to ensure eligibility for the deduction.
